Patents by Inventor John Milanski

John Milanski has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 6931656
    Abstract: An animated virtual creature is generated on a display such as a television set, in order to simulate a pet or to facilitate user interface functions. In one embodiment, one or more signals corresponding to the program being watched are monitored. When certain events are detected based on this monitoring, the animated character is controlled in a manner that corresponds to the detected event. In another embodiment, the animated virtual creature responds to program selections made by a user in a program recommendation system.
    Type: Grant
    Filed: October 11, 2000
    Date of Patent: August 16, 2005
    Assignee: Koninklijke Philips Electronics N.V.
    Inventors: Larry J. Eshelman, Srinivas Gutta, John Milanski, Hugo J. Strubbe
  • Patent number: 6795808
    Abstract: An interaction simulator, such as a chatterbot, is connected with an external database, such as an electronic program guide. The information gathered during interaction, particularly conversational, is parsed and used to augment the database data. The interaction simulator may be guided by the data residing in the database so as to help fill in recognizable gaps by, for example, intermittently asking questions relating to the subject data requirement. The interaction simulator may be provided with specific response templates based on the needs of the database and a corresponding set of templates to extract the information required by the database. Another example database may be for recording and indexing by key word stories or other free-form verbal data uttered by the user. The interaction simulator may be programmed to help the user develop the story using templates designed for this purpose.
    Type: Grant
    Filed: October 30, 2000
    Date of Patent: September 21, 2004
    Assignee: Koninklijke Philips Electronics N.V.
    Inventors: Hugo J. Strubbe, Larry J. Eshelman, Srinivas Gutta, John Milanski, Daniel Pelletier
  • Patent number: 6778226
    Abstract: The appearance of a cabinet for a device (e.g., a television) is dynamically controlled. One way of controlling the appearance of the cabinet is by providing a display panel on the cabinet. At least one input is obtained from an input device and processed by a controller. Based on these inputs, the controller sends signals to the display panel to change the appearance of the display panel. Lamps and heat-sensitive materials may be used to effectuate the desired change in appearance. The cabinet display features may be controlled to give the device the appearance of having a persona or of being an independent animate being. For example, lights in the cabinet could flash to suggest the device is laughing in response to the detection of a laugh track in a sitcom being displayed on the device. Patterns and colors can be generated to reflect moods according to the preferences of an interaction-design programmer.
    Type: Grant
    Filed: October 11, 2000
    Date of Patent: August 17, 2004
    Assignee: Koninklijke Philips Electronics N.V.
    Inventors: Larry J. Eshelman, Srinivas Gutta, John Milanski, Hugo J. Strubbe
  • Patent number: 6774795
    Abstract: An electronic assistant, incorporates electronic functions in a personal object that the user finds indispensable. Examples of personal objects include a cane, a walking stick, a walker, a wheelchair, a personal transportation vehicle, a purse, a key holder, a watch, a pendant, a hearing aid, an eyeglass frame, or a crutch. Electronics may include a PDA, a cell phone, a navigation module, a biosensor module, and an emergency alert module. The navigation module might include a GPS, an altimeter, an electronic compass, and/or a stored map. Biosensors may be directly incorporated into the personal device or communicate with a receiver therein if the biosensor is required to be attached directly to the user's body or surgically implanted. The emergency alert module may include an emergency button, and an emergency notification sequence stored in the electronic assistant capable of calling for assistance through the cell phone.
    Type: Grant
    Filed: June 30, 2001
    Date of Patent: August 10, 2004
    Assignee: Koninklijke Philips Electroncs N.V.
    Inventors: Larry J. Eshelman, Srinivas Gutta, Hugo J. Strubbe, John Milanski
  • Patent number: 6731307
    Abstract: An interaction simulator uses computer vision, and inputs of other modalities, to analyze the user's mental state and/or personality. The mental state and/or personality are classified and this information used to guide conversation and other interaction. In a chatterbot embodiment, the substance of the conversation may be altered in response to the mental state and/or personality class, for example, by changing the topic of conversation to a favorite subject when the user is sad or by telling a joke when the user is in a good mood.
    Type: Grant
    Filed: October 30, 2000
    Date of Patent: May 4, 2004
    Assignee: Koninklije Philips Electronics N.V.
    Inventors: Hugo J. Strubbe, Larry J. Eshelman, Srinivas Gutta, John Milanski
  • Patent number: 6728679
    Abstract: An interaction simulator has the ability to dynamically update response templates and response data by retrieving current information from a data source. The interaction simulator may interact verbally or by other means such as gesture, typed text, or other means to generate a “dialogue. ” The interaction simulator, by dynamically updating its responses, is able to be more interesting and useful to users and also more personally relevant than prior art, so-called chatterbots. The device also reduces the required number of rules and library of response data that must be retained compared to prior art conversation simulators. The criteria used to create new response data can come from fixed specifications, for example, the current weather, or from the content of previous conversations (for example, the system creating a new template about a topic indicated by the user to be of interest to him/her).
    Type: Grant
    Filed: October 30, 2000
    Date of Patent: April 27, 2004
    Assignee: Koninklijke Philips Electronics N.V.
    Inventors: Hugo J. Strubbe, Larry J. Eshelman, Srinivas Gutta, John Milanski, Daniel Pelletier
  • Patent number: 6721706
    Abstract: An interaction simulator, such as a chatterbot, is enabled to simulate an awareness of the user to generate an interaction that is more natural and appropriate than prior art chatterbots. For example, the device may employ machine vision to detect the number of persons present or the activity of the user and respond accordingly by interrupting its output or by inviting a conversation or other interaction when a user approaches. The device may modify its responses according to the user's activity, for example, by playing music when the user falls asleep or requesting an introduction when another user speaks. The device may also respond to unrecognized changes in the situation by inquiring about what is going on to stimulate interaction or generate new responses.
    Type: Grant
    Filed: October 30, 2000
    Date of Patent: April 13, 2004
    Assignee: Koninklijke Philips Electronics N.V.
    Inventors: Hugo J. Strubbe, Larry J. Eshelman, Srinivas Gutta, John Milanski, Daniel Pelletier
  • Patent number: 6721704
    Abstract: The present invention is a telephone conversation quality enhancer using an emotional conversational analyzer for analyzing the conversation between a primary party and a secondary party. Its focus is on improving the nature of the conversation quality by first analyzing the nature and quality of the conversation, determining how the analysis fits into a set of conversation conditions, and then determining what conversational aids may be used to assist in the enhancement of the conversation. The apparatus includes a microprocessor which communicates with the first and second telephone units and a database which stores conversational conditions and conversational aids. A conversation analyzer in the microprocessor analyzes the conversation occurring between the first and second telephone units and provides an analysis of the conversation. The microprocessor then applies the conversational conditions to the conversation analysis to select conversational aids.
    Type: Grant
    Filed: August 28, 2001
    Date of Patent: April 13, 2004
    Assignee: Koninklijke Philips Electronics N.V.
    Inventors: Hugo J. Strubbe, Larry J. Eshelman, Srinivas Gutta, John Milanski, Pelletier Daniel
  • Patent number: 6681004
    Abstract: The telephone memory aid provides a database to a primary party for storing and retrieving personal information about a secondary party, including summary information related to communication exchanges between the primary and secondary parties. The summary information includes, for example, the date and time of prior telephone calls and the topics discussed. This secondary party information, including the summaries of prior telephone calls, is available for review by the primary party during future phone calls with the secondary party. The telephone memory aid also facilitates entry of information into the database through speech recognition algorithms and through question and answer sessions with the primary and secondary parties.
    Type: Grant
    Filed: March 22, 2001
    Date of Patent: January 20, 2004
    Assignee: Koninklijke Philips Electronics N.V.
    Inventors: Hugo J. Strubbe, Larry J. Eshelman, Srinivas Gutta, John Milanski, James A. Hoekema
  • Patent number: 6611206
    Abstract: Briefly, an alarm system monitors conditions of an independent person, yet one requiring some supervision, such as an elderly person living alone at home. The system monitors a variety of independent signals and combines them to recognize subtle cues that may indicate there will be a need for intervention by a supervisor.
    Type: Grant
    Filed: March 15, 2001
    Date of Patent: August 26, 2003
    Assignee: Koninklijke Philips Electronics N.V.
    Inventors: Larry J. Eshelman, Srinivas Gutta, Daniel Pelletier, Hugo J. Strubbe, John Milanski
  • Publication number: 20030002646
    Abstract: A system and method for directing an incoming telephone call. The system comprises a control unit that receives images associated with two or more regions of a local environment. The two or more regions are each serviced by a respective telephone extension. The control unit processes the images to identify, from a group of known persons associated with the local environment, any one or more known persons located in the respective regions. For each known person so identified, an indicium is generated that associates the known person with the respective region in which the known person is located.
    Type: Application
    Filed: June 27, 2001
    Publication date: January 2, 2003
    Applicant: Philips Electronics North America Corp.
    Inventors: Srinivas Gutta, Larry Eshelman, Hugo J. Strubbe, John Milanski
  • Publication number: 20020171551
    Abstract: Briefly, an alarm system monitors conditions of an independent person, yet one requiring some supervision, such as an elderly person living alone at home. The system monitors a variety of independent signals and combines them to recognize subtle cues that may indicate there will be a need for intervention by a supervisor.
    Type: Application
    Filed: March 15, 2001
    Publication date: November 21, 2002
    Inventors: Larry J. Eshelman, Srinivas Gutta, Daniel Pelletier, Hugo J. Strubbe, John Milanski
  • Publication number: 20020136378
    Abstract: The present invention is a telephone memory aid that is focused on how to capture information during a telephone call and allow entry of information by the user or other party into a database that may be used in future calls. In future calls, the telephone memory aid would allow the user to call or be called by a desired second party and see all of the stored personal information related to the second party. This might include name, date of last call, topics that were discussed in the last telephone call, names of family members, vacation plans, hobbies, and similar such information. The purpose is to improve the conversation flow and communications between the parties of the telephone call.
    Type: Application
    Filed: March 22, 2001
    Publication date: September 26, 2002
    Applicant: Koninklijke Philips Electronics N.V.
    Inventors: Hugo J. Strubbe, Larry J. Eshelman, Srinivas Gutta, John Milanski, James A. Hoekema
  • Publication number: 20020116710
    Abstract: A TV viewer profile initializer for reducing the time it takes for an implicit profiler-based TV recommender to produce accurate TV recommendations. The profiles initializer utilizes stereotype profiles from a substantial pool of TV viewing behavior of a representative number of TV viewers. By applying clustering methods to such data, stereotype profiles can emerge. New viewers are then be offered a selection of stereotype profiles to choose from to initialize their own personal TV viewing profile. Thus, a single choice will suffice to provide a predictable TV show recommender that is presumably fairly close to a viewer's own preferences. After this initialization, the profile can be adapted by the user's own viewing behavior to migrate from the initial stereotype towards a more accurate profile of the user.
    Type: Application
    Filed: February 22, 2001
    Publication date: August 22, 2002
    Inventors: James David Schaffer, Paul John Rankin, Keith Mathias, John Milanski